About This Vintage 1948 Edition

"Expository Notes on the Gospel of Mark" by H. A. Ironside, Litt.D, is a detailed commentary on the Gospel of Mark, offering insights from one of the 20th century's respected Bible teachers. Published by Loizeaux Brothers, Inc. in New York, this third printing from November 1956 follows the original 1948 edition. H. A. Ironside is known for his clear, accessible teaching style, making complex theological concepts understandable. This hardcover edition is a valuable resource for students and scholars of biblical studies, providing comprehensive expository notes.
